Mir hosts the popular Capital Talk show on Geo TV, which said that gunmen fired at him with automatic weapons.
He suffered three gunshot wounds and was being treated in hospital. This was the second attempt on his life.
In 2012, a bomb was recovered from his car.
Mir is seen as a critic of Pakistan's powerful security institutions, including the army and the Inter-Services Intelligence (ISI) spy agency.
Geo TV reported that Mir had informed the government and close friends that ISI and its chief would be responsible for any attempt on his life.
Global media watchdog group Reporters Without Borders said in its annual report released in February that Pakistan is one of the world's most dangerous places for journalists.
In March, Raza Rumi, of the private Express TV, was targeted in the eastern city of Lahore.
The journalist, who frequently criticises the Taliban, survived but his driver was killed and a security guard was wounded.
